There is an entry recorded 20 February 1845 in the Nauvoo City Treasury Ledger for $16.00 for seven orders to John Mackley dated 5 October 1844. This pay order could be one of the orders mentioned in that entry. Mackley’s account in the ledger notes nineteen orders on collector dated 5 October 1844 totaling $41.00. This and the three other extant pay orders for Mackley dated 5 October 1844 likely correspond to four of those nineteen orders. (Nauvoo City Treasury Ledger, 32, 146; Pay Order, William Clayton to Nauvoo City Collector for John Mackley, 5 Oct. 1844–A; Pay Order, William Clayton to Nauvoo City Collector for John Mackley, 5 Oct. 1844–B; Pay Order, William Clayton to Nauvoo City Collector for John Mackley, 5 Oct. 1844–C.)
